MINUTES     for the    General Meeting for the Murray Bridge Gliding Club Inc.    held at Hangar 19 Pallamana airfield on                Saturday 22nd May 2021

present: Lindsay,Colin, Rob, Ian, Susanne, Frank, Richard, Martin, Greg, Emilis

apologies: Tim, Peter, Steve, Jean-Luc, Roman

1.0   Minutes of March 2021 AGM          moved       Lindsay  seconded   Colin   accepted

2.1 President opened the meeting  2.30pm

2.2 Treasurer           
The meeting conversation canvassed club funds, their growth and security. The general view was that gradual accumulation at low risk suited the club better than complex or volatile options.

Rob offered to circulate more diverse term fund options being looked at by other aviation organisations.

The concept of club electronic banking supported by Steve and Greg led to this motion, allowing the Treasurer to test the arrangement with NAB.

"That Murray Bridge Gliding Club decides to enable single signatory electronic banking,
signator club Treasurer to activate.
Treasurer to check on setting of maximum withdrawal $ limit, and ability where payments are made to include immediate bank email confirmation to club President."
moved   Colin  seconded  Ian   accepted

Greg to confirm these details to the next meeting.

The meeting general feeling was that a Flinders trip in 2021 was beyond the club current planning scope, in view of issues there - limited accommodation with long lead booking times, weather obstacles to fly in and out, owner preferred single club use of site, etc    

Members are to search out details on closer possibles -
Clare - which also gives access to Black Springs, Peterborough, Jamestown etc
for accommodation, airfield access, etc.
